Abstract

The utility model relates to dual-surface photoactive color paper, which comprises a support, a photoactive layer and a protecting layer, wherein a light blocking layer and an insulating layer are arranged between the support and the photoactive layer, the insulating layer is located between light blocking layer and the photoactive layer, and a second light blocking layer, a second insulating layer, a second photoactive layer and a second protecting layer which are symmetrically arranged with the light blocking layer, the insulating layer and the photoactive layer and the protecting layer are arranged on the other surface of the support. The dual-surface photoactive silver halide color paper which is provided by the utility model has rich color, wide color range, rich image level, high definition, high efficiency and low cost.

A kind of double-face light sensation colour photographic paper
Technical field
The utility model relates to a kind of photographic material, particularly a kind of can the two-sided colour paper that carries out sensitization.
Background technology
Traditional single face light sensation colour photographic paper can only simultaneously expose at printing paper, forms the single face image, and reverse side does not have image.Can only be contained in photo frame or photograph album the inside single face like this and appreciate, can't enlarge the usable range of printing paper as image-carrier.And reduced the utilization factor of support, increased manufacturing cost.In recent years, the printed on both sides of numeral short run is a dark horse, year market capacity enlarges rapidly, based on digital printed and digital short run printed on both sides inkjet printing, can on limited flat carrier, bring the consumer double graph text information, be widely used in aspects such as business card, personalized desk calendar, menu, auction room's sample volume, hotel sample board, invitation card, work card, trade promotion promotional pamphlet, develop and print industry for traditional silver salt and bring tremendous loss and stern challenge.The printed on both sides of numeral short run has improved efficient to a certain extent, has satisfied the demand of consumer's personalization, but still has existed color few, and colour gamut is narrow, and image does not have level, poor definition, and the delivery cycle is long, the problem that cost is high relatively.
The patent No. is that the Chinese utility model patent of ZL200520023024.5 discloses a kind of laser film processor of double-sided exposure and the double-sided light sensitive paper of use thereof, its exposing unit is provided with the laser explosure device that 2 symmetries are installed in the both sides up and down of exposure region, the laser explosure device carries out exposure image respectively to the duplex paper two sides under the sweep signal control of circuit control unit output, printing paper is finished through the flushing unit and is enlarged and print, thereby realizes double-face imaging.The duplex paper of describing in this patent comprises paper substrate, first photographic layer and first protective seam; it adopts the colour paper manufacturing technology of generally acknowledging to be symmetrical arranged second photographic layer and second protective seam at the another side of paper substrate; owing to adopt the two sides exposure; photographic property to product has a negative impact easily, descends as Fog density rising, light sensitivity.
Summary of the invention
Technical problem to be solved in the utility model is: overcome the defective of above-mentioned prior art, a kind of rich color is provided, colour gamut is wide, and image level is abundant, sharpness height, efficient height, the double-sided light sensitive silver-halide color printing paper that cost is low.
For addressing the above problem, the technical scheme that the utility model is taked is:
A kind of double-face light sensation colour photographic paper, it comprises support, photographic layer and protective seam, wherein, is provided with shading layer and barrier layer between support and photographic layer, described barrier layer is between shading layer and photographic layer; Be provided with second shading layer, second barrier layer, second photographic layer and second protective seam with above-mentioned shading layer, barrier layer, photographic layer and protective seam symmetric arrangement at the another side of support.
Above-mentioned double-face light sensation colour photographic paper, the described barrier layer and second barrier layer are hydrophilic gelatin layers, thickness is 0.5~5 μ m.
Above-mentioned double-face light sensation colour photographic paper, the described shading layer and second shading layer are hydrophilic gelatin layers, thickness is 0.5~5 μ m.
Above-mentioned double-face light sensation colour photographic paper, the reflection density of the described shading layer and second shading layer is 0.10~3.00.
Above-mentioned double-face light sensation colour photographic paper, described photographic layer is formed after respectively three layers of silver halide of three kinds of coloured light sensitization of red, green, blue and corresponding colour coupler evenly being coated with.
When traditional single face printing paper exposed, light was through on the paper substrate that reaches white behind the emulsion layer, and wherein a part of light sees through paper substrate, and another part light is the reflected back emulsion layer again, thereby has improved the photosensitive property of product.Because double-sided light sensitive silver-halide color printing paper two sides all scribbles emulsion, during the single face exposure, the part light that sees through paper substrate causes the emulsion sensitization of another side, form interference images, negative effect such as the Fog density that the photographic property of product is produced rises, light sensitivity descends, therefore, must eliminate the part light that sees through paper substrate.For addressing the above problem, contain shading layer in the silver-halide color printing paper of the double-sided light sensitive that the utility model provides, its effect is to absorb the light that sees through paper substrate, prevents unexposed emulsion side photosensitive imaging.Described shading layer is the hydrophilic gelatin layer that contains extinction material, anti-pollutant, stabilizing agent.Extinction material wherein can be but be not limited only in collargol, anti-halo dye and the carbon black one or more that this extinction material can come off fully, does not influence the whiteness of product in the development process.
The thickness of shading layer has determined what of amount of extinction material to a certain extent, extinction material is absorbing through in the light of paper substrate, also absorbed the light that part should the reflected back emulsion layer, the easy like this exposure deficiency that causes reduces the photographic property of product.Therefore, the thickness that needs the suitable shading layer of screening is guaranteeing to absorb the light that sees through paper substrate, when avoiding another emulsion side sensitization interference images to occur, reduce absorption to light that should the reflected back emulsion layer as far as possible, reduce to the product photographic property negative effect.The thickness of shading layer of the present utility model is 0.5~5 μ m, but is not limited thereto.
The resistance light action of shading layer mainly is to realize by extinction material, same consumption, different extinctions may produce different reflection densities, so the reflection density of extinction material determined the extinction effect that shading layer is final, and it is defined as the logarithm of incident light quantity and reflection light quantity ratio.Reflection density described in the utility model is 0.10~3.00,
In the preparation process of shading layer, may produce residual development oxidation product, this material is gone here and there layer easily to adjacent photographic layer, with the colour coupler generation coupling reaction in the photographic layer, form unnecessary color, cause the photographic fog of product to rise, therefore need between shading layer and photographic layer, increase by a barrier layer, described barrier layer is the hydrophilic gelatin layer that contains anti-pollutant, by the thickness of adjustment gelatin and the consumption of antistain agent, reduce the content of development oxidation product, prevent residual development oxidation product or anti-halo dye string layer.Hydrophilic gelatin coating is too thin, is not enough to stop residual development oxidation product or anti-halo dye string layer, seals in adjacent emulsion layer easily, causes the rising of photographic fog or the reduction of photographic property.Hydrophilic gelatin coating is too thick, and the perviousness of influence processing soup causes collargol or anti-halo dye not to come off fully, causes the minimum density of product to rise, and influences the whiteness of product.The thickness of barrier layer of the present utility model is 0.5~5 μ m, but is not limited thereto.
Photographic layer described in the utility model by respectively to three layers of silver halide of three kinds of coloured light sensitization of red, green, blue and corresponding colour coupler evenly coating form.Described photographic layer and protective seam form by the general manufacturing technology manufacturing of known colour paper.
Support described in the utility model is known colour paper paper substrate, no specific (special) requirements.
The double-sided light sensitive silver-halide color printing paper that the utility model provides prepares by following method:
At first prepare the shading layer that contains extinction material, photographic gelatin and antistain agent, the barrier layer that contains gelatin and antistain agent, preparing redgreenblue photographic layer and protective seam respectively according to the known manufacturing technology of colour paper.Adopt the extrusion coated mode, earlier shading layer is uniformly coated on a side of the support of two-sided bottom, again barrier layer is uniformly coated on after the condensation drying on the print that is coated with shading layer, again three color sensation photospheres and protective seam once is uniformly coated on the print that has scribbled shading layer and barrier layer after the condensation drying; After the condensation drying was finished, equally the opposite side at the support of two-sided bottom evenly was coated with shading layer, barrier layer, photographic layer and protective seam successively according to identical method, obtains double-sided light sensitive silver-halide color printing paper print after the condensation drying.
Compared with prior art, the double-sided light sensitive silver-halide color printing paper rich color that the utility model provides, colour gamut is wide, and image level is abundant, the sharpness height, the efficient height, cost is low.

Embodiment
The utility model is described in further detail below by specific embodiment.
Embodiment 1
Preparation contains the shading layer of extinction material, photographic gelatin and antistain agent and contains gelatin and the barrier layer of antistain agent, adjust coating weight, use the extrusion coated mode, earlier shading layer is uniformly coated on the support, it is 0.5 μ m that the thickness of minusing test shading layer is adopted in dry back, and density is 0.10; Barrier layer is uniformly coated on the print that is coated with shading layer, it is 0.5 μ m that the thickness of minusing test barrier layer is adopted in dry back again.Adopt known colour paper technology of preparing at last, photographic layer and protective layer used extrusion coating machine are uniformly coated on the print that scribbles shading layer and barrier layer; After finishing equally at another side according to identical method coating shading layer, barrier layer, photographic layer and protective seam, the thickness that obtains shading layer is that 0.5 μ m, density are 0.10, barrier layer thickness is the duplex paper print of 0.5 μ m.
